David Dary, a respected journalist and prolific author who shepherded the University of Oklahoma journalism program's transition from a school to a degree-granting college, died Thursday. He was 83. A Manhattan, Kansas native, Dary was recruited to Norman in 1989 to lead the H.H. Herbert School of Journalism and Mass Communication. To add more books, click here . Educator since 2017. 14,950 answers | Certified Educator Share Cite Just before the big rumble's about to kick off, Paul Holden ...David Dary (Cowboy Culture) describes the impact of Texas trail drivers on the Kansas boot industry of the 1870s. Many cowboys bought new clothes when they reached the end of the trail. Many also purchased new boots. The Texans seem to have preferred custom-made boots. In Abilene, Tom C. McInerney employed as many as twenty men in his boot shop ...
